Ajax 0-2 Inter Milan: A Tactical Breakdown of the September 17 Clash
In a highly anticipated matchup on September 17, 2025, Inter Milan secured a commanding 2-0 victory over Ajax in their UEFA Champions League group stage encounter at the iconic Johan Cruyff Arena. This result not only showcased Inter’s tactical superiority but also underscored Ajax’s ongoing struggles in Europe’s elite competition. With two well-executed goals from their star forwards, Inter demonstrated their lethal attack while Ajax faced criticism for a lack of creativity and defensive lapses. As both teams look ahead to the remainder of the tournament, this analysis delves into the key moments, strategic decisions, and player performances that defined this compelling clash in Amsterdam.
Analyzing Ajax’s Tactical Missteps in Their Defeat to Inter Milan
Ajax’s performance against Inter Milan on September 17, 2025, revealed several tactical missteps that contributed to their disappointing 0-2 defeat. A primary issue was their failure to maintain defensive discipline during key moments, particularly in transitional phases. This allowed Inter to exploit gaps, resulting in counter-attacks that ultimately led to both of their goals. The Ajax backline often appeared disorganized, failing to communicate effectively and leaving open spaces that a seasoned team like Inter capitalized on. Additionally, Ajax’s midfield struggled to regain control after losing possession, leading to a plethora of unchallenged opportunities for the opposition.
Furthermore, Ajax’s offensive strategy lacked cohesion and fluidity, marked by a reliance on individual brilliance rather than cohesive team play. The forwards were often isolated, making it difficult for them to create meaningful chances. Key players seemed hesitant in their movement off the ball, which diminished the effectiveness of attacking plays. This rigidity was magnified by Inter’s tactical setup, which effectively neutralized Ajax’s creative outlets. Compounding the problem was Ajax’s inability to adapt during the match; despite evident struggles, there was a noticeable absence of tactical changes to counter Inter’s game plan, leaving fans questioning the team’s adaptability under pressure.
